Hacker releases source code to jailbreak iOS 8.4.1

Jailbreak iOS 8.4.1

Luca Todesco, a student and "potential developer" based in Italy, has released the source code to jailbreak iOS 8.4.1, the latest version of iOS 8 and that many users have installed on their devices. The release of this code will lead to managing the jailbreak on all iPads and iPhones running iOS 8.4.1, something that many users are looking forward to.

Todesco, which discovered two vulnerabilities in one day with OS X Yosemite in August, uploaded the code on GitHub with the codename "Yalu". The accompanying description says, "source code is incomplete for iOS 8.4.1 jailbreak."

The incomplete refers to the fact that jailbreak source code is limited to booting with tethered only. The reason given for this is that the untethered code does not belong to Tedesco, therefore it cannot make it available to everyone, at the moment.

The source code only gives you the ability to jailbreak iOS 8.4.1 (if you know what you are doing), which in turn provides OpenSSH access. However, please note that because this jailbreak is incomplete, don't install Cydia, and it is recommended not to install manually.

The code is not of much use to the average iOS user for now, but for users with advanced knowledge on the subject. It's only a matter of time before someone puts it to good use and the jailbreak is fully released. Even Todesco himself has joked on Twitter that "yalu for iPhone 6 will be up and running very soon."

In the meantime, it is advised that you stay away from source code if you are not entirely sure how to use it. You could end up doing great damage to your iOS device by trying to jailbreak yourself..

If you still don't want to upgrade to iOS 9 because you're hoping to jailbreak iOS 8.4.1, then your patience could pay off soon. But remember that you should not update in the meantime, because there is no way to go back to iOS 8.1.4, once you have installed iOS 9 on your device.
